// ------------------------------------------------------------------------ //
// XOOPS Cube/XOOPS Default Theme Hack Ver4.0 //
// Just enjoy! Internet for everyone!! //
// wanikoo <
http://www.wanisys.net/ > /
// ------------------------------------------------------------------------ //
// Based on XOOPS Cube/XOOPS Default Theme //
// ---JavaScript Author-- //
// - prototype.js ( Sam Stephenson
http://prototype.conio.net/ ) //
// - rico.js ( Sabre Airline Solutions
http://openrico.org/rico/ ) //
// - Scriptaculous ( Thomas Fuchs
http://script.aculo.us ) //
// - javawin ( bastien Gruhier,
http://blogus.xilinus.com/pages/javawin ) //
// ------------------------------------------------------------------------ //
With this Theme,
You can D&D(Drag and Drop)/Resize each block of your XOOPS Cube/XOOPS Site!
It means visitor can reorder/resize blocks freely by D&Ding each of them.
^^;;
-Ver4.0-
Now you can browse/experience your XOOPS Cube/XOOPS Site on Windows-like Interface!
(Basic Windows: Left Block Window, Right Block Window, Center Block Window, Main Content Window )
+ TrashCan Window(Trashcan function to restore closed windows).
-Ver3.0-
Now you can slide up/down each block and each blocksecton of your XOOPS Cube/XOOPS Site.
and
With Handle,you can D&D(Drag and Drop) each block of your XOOPS Cube/XOOPS Site.
-Ver2.0-
Now you can minimize/restore each block of your XOOPS Cube/XOOPS Site like Windows.
-
-
I changed some codes of javascript files(used in these themes)to fix some bugs and add new functions!
so...
when you use these themes, you have to use javascript files modified by me and included in this package.
####################
Download:(Ver4.0)
http://dev.xoops.org/modules/xfmod/project/showfiles.php?group_id=1189&release_id=967&dl=2404
####################
-----------------------
---------------------
.New themes(with new functions) added to this package.
(you can browse/experience your XOOPS Cube/XOOPS Site on Windows-like Interface!
(Basic Windows: Left Block Window, Right Block Window, Center Block Window, Main Content Window )
(All windows are draggable, resizbale, closable -common in win2 themes,win3 themes,win4 themes)
(each window has close button/slideup(minimize)button/slidedown(restore)button -common in win3 themes,win4 themes )
(+ Trashcan function to restore closed windows -common in win3 themes,win4 themes)
(each block in each window has minimize/restore button -only in win4 themes )
.bug of size3themes fixed.
( Slide up/down function of each block section didn't work properly on Firefox.)
-------------------------------------------------------------------------------
Ver4.0 New themes added to this package!
------------------------------------------------------------------------------
--------------------
cube_win2default theme ( for XOOPS Cube 2.1 )
---------------------
Name="Default Theme-Win2(Window) Version"
Depends=Legacy_RenderSystem
Url="http://xoopscube.org and http://www.wanisys.net/"
Version="4.00"
Author=XOOPS Cube Project Team and Wanikoo and Authors of scriptaculous, prototype and javawin
ScreenShot="screenshot.png"
Description="Default theme-Win2(Window) Version of XOOPS Cube 2.1"
--------------------
cube_win3default theme ( for XOOPS Cube 2.1 )
---------------------
Name="Default Theme-Win3(Window with Trashcan) Version"
Depends=Legacy_RenderSystem
Url="http://xoopscube.org and http://www.wanisys.net/"
Version="4.00"
Author=XOOPS Cube Project Team and Wanikoo and Authors of scriptaculous, prototype and javawin
ScreenShot="screenshot.png"
Description="Default theme-Win3(Window with Trashcan) Version of XOOPS Cube 2.1"
--------------------
cube_win4default theme ( for XOOPS Cube 2.1 )
---------------------
Name="Default Theme-Win4(Window with Trashcan and Block Resize) Version"
Depends=Legacy_RenderSystem
Url="http://xoopscube.org and http://www.wanisys.net/"
Version="4.00"
Author=XOOPS Cube Project Team and Wanikoo and Authors of scriptaculous, prototype and javawin
ScreenShot="screenshot.png"
Description="Default theme-Win4(Window with Trashcan and Block Resize) Version of XOOPS Cube 2.1"
--------------------
win2default theme ( for XOOPS 2.0.x JP )
---------------------
Name="Default Theme-Win2(Window) Version"
Depends=Legacy_RenderSystem
Url="http://xoopscube.org and http://www.wanisys.net/"
Version="4.00"
Author=XOOPS Cube Project Team and Wanikoo and Authors of scriptaculous, prototype and javawin
ScreenShot="screenshot.png"
Description="Default theme-Win2(Window) Version of XOOPS 2.0.x JP"
--------------------
win3default theme ( for XOOPS 2.0.x JP )
---------------------
Name="Default Theme-Win3(Window with Trashcan) Version"
Depends=Legacy_RenderSystem
Url="http://xoopscube.org and http://www.wanisys.net/"
Version="4.00"
Author=XOOPS Cube Project Team and Wanikoo and Authors of scriptaculous, prototype and javawin
ScreenShot="screenshot.png"
Description="Default theme-Win3(Window with Trashcan) Version of XOOPS 2.0.x JP"
--------------------
win4default theme ( for XOOPS 2.0.x JP )
---------------------
Name="Default Theme-Win4(Window with Trashcan and Block Resize) Version"
Depends=Legacy_RenderSystem
Url="http://xoopscube.org and http://www.wanisys.net/"
Version="4.00"
Author=XOOPS Cube Project Team and Wanikoo and Authors of scriptaculous, prototype and javawin
ScreenShot="screenshot.png"
Description="Default theme-Win4(Window with Trashcan and Block Resize) Version of XOOPS 2.0.x JP"
--------------------
win2xdefault theme ( for XOOPS 2.0.x JP )
---------------------
Name="Default Theme-Win2(Window) Version"
Depends=Legacy_RenderSystem
Url="https://xoops.org and http://www.wanisys.net/"
Version="4.00"
Author=XOOPS Project Team and Wanikoo and Authors of scriptaculous, prototype and javawin
ScreenShot="screenshot.png"
Description="Default theme-Win2(Window) Version of XOOPS 2.0.x"
--------------------
win3xdefault theme ( for XOOPS 2.0.x JP )
---------------------
Name="Default Theme-Win3(Window with Trashcan) Version"
Depends=Legacy_RenderSystem
Url="https://xoops.org and http://www.wanisys.net/"
Version="4.00"
Author=XOOPS Project Team and Wanikoo and Authors of scriptaculous, prototype and javawin
ScreenShot="screenshot.png"
Description="Default theme-Win3(Window with Trashcan) Version of XOOPS 2.0.x"
--------------------
win4xdefault theme ( for XOOPS 2.0.x JP )
---------------------
Name="Default Theme-Win4(Window with Trashcan and Block Resize) Version"
Depends=Legacy_RenderSystem
Url="https://xoops.org and http://www.wanisys.net/"
Version="4.00"
Author=XOOPS Project Team and Wanikoo and Authors of scriptaculous, prototype and javawin
ScreenShot="screenshot.png"
Description="Default theme-Win4(Window with Trashcan and Block Resize) Version of XOOPS 2.0.x"
--------------------------------------------------------------------------------------
-----------------------------------------
Credit of Javascripts used in these themes
-----------------------------------------
prototype.js
/* Prototype JavaScript framework, version 1.4.0
* (c) 2005 Sam Stephenson
*
* Prototype is freely distributable under the terms of an MIT-style license.
* For details, see the Prototype web site: http://prototype.conio.net/
*
/*--------------------------------------------------------------------------*/
Rico.js
/**
*
* Copyright 2005 Sabre Airline Solutions
*
* Licensed under the Apache License, Version 2.0 (the "License"); you may not use this
* file except in compliance with the License. You may obtain a copy of the License at
*
* http://www.apache.org/licenses/LICENSE-2.0
*
* Unless required by applicable law or agreed to in writing, software distributed under the
* License is distributed on an "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ND,
* either express or implied. See the License for the specific language governing permissions
* and limitations under the License.
**/
scriptaculous.js
// Copyright (c) 2005 Thomas Fuchs (http://script.aculo.us, http://mir.aculo.us)
// MIT-style license
// Permission is hereby granted, free of charge, to any person obtaining
// a copy of this software and associated documentation files (the
// "Software"), to deal in the Software without restriction, including
// without limitation the rights to use, copy, modify, merge, publish,
// distribute, sublicense, and/or sell copies of the Software, and to
// permit persons to whom the Software is furnished to do so, subject to
// the following conditions:
window.js
// Copyright (c) 2006 bastien Gruhier (http://xilinus.com, http://itseb.com)
// MIT-style license
// Permission is hereby granted, free of charge, to any person obtaining
// a copy of this software and associated documentation files (the
// "Software"), to deal in the Software without restriction, including
// without limitation the rights to use, copy, modify, merge, publish,
// distribute, sublicense, and/or sell copies of the Software, and to
// permit persons to whom the Software is furnished to do so, subject to
// the following conditions:
------------------
Browser Support:
------------------
This has been tested on IE 5.5, IE 6, Firefox 1.0x/Win, Camino/Mac, Firefox 1.5x/Mac.
( Currently, some themes are not supported on Safari )
-------------------
How to install
------------------
Just copy it to /themes dir.
and..
Make it workable through Preference configuration section of Admin menu
----------------
-------------------------------------------------------------------
How to apply new func(of Ver4.0) to other XOOPS Cube/XOOPS themes
--------------------------------------------------------------------
You can more easily apply new functions to other XOOPS(Cube) Themes!
1) add new css links after XOOPS css link (referring to theme.html of each theme.)
2) add new javascript codes after xoops_js
( please refer to theme.html of each theme ! You can easily find it. )
3) You have to environ block loop with this code!
~~
*WARNING
win3 theme and win4 theme has some codes(related with trashcan func) before block-loop.
~~~
3) modify each block-loop refering to theme.html of each theme!
I believe you can do this job easily.
Notice:
You can customize each window by modifying css file.
(I mean you can assign different css file to each window. )
(ex: basic windows use default.css and trashcan window use theme1.css. )
(For more information, please analyze window.js and theme.html of each theme )
----------------------------------------------------------------------------------
--------------------------------------------
From wanikoo
the most educational site, wanisys.net